Contaminated Air Filters
Contaminated air filters frequently cause AC issues by impeding airflow across the evaporator coil and requiring your system to function outside its designed pressure and temperature ranges. This airflow restriction diminishes heat transfer effectiveness, raises blower workload, and can result in coil icing, short cycling, and uneven supply temperatures throughout your home.
You'll frequently detect diminished vents, extended run times, elevated energy consumption, and increased dust accumulation when filter maintenance gets ignored. A saturated filter can also distort static pressure readings, making diagnostic testing necessary before you conclude a deeper mechanical fault exists. You should replace or clean filters according to manufacturer specifications, occupancy levels, and indoor air conditions. Throughout service, your technician should check filter sizing, installation direction, cabinet sealing, and pressure drop to verify proper system airflow and stable operation.
Refrigerant Loss
Coolant leaks from your AC equipment lead to decreased cooling performance because the evaporator and condenser can't preserve the required pressure levels and saturation temperatures for correct heat exchange. You'll frequently notice signs like increased run times, reduced supply air, coil icing, or increased superheat and compressor discharge temperatures.
Typical leak points are brazed joints, Schrader cores, service valves, evaporator tubing, or rubbed line sets. Corrosion, vibration, faulty installation, and age accelerate failure. Topping off refrigerant without fixing the leak hides the fault and can break code or manufacturer specifications. A certified technician must employ nitrogen pressure testing, electronic instruments, or ultraviolet dye for leak detection, then complete refrigerant recovery before opening the circuit. The unit must have evacuation, accurate factory charge weight-in, and validation of proper subcooling and performance after repairs.

Concerns With Refrigerant Or Ducts
Apart from air movement limitations, refrigerant faults and duct issues can also result in your AC delivering hot or insufficient air. When refrigerant volume declines due to leaks, your evaporator is unable to remove enough heat, so discharge temperatures increase and refrigeration capacity decreases. You should not refill refrigerant without proper diagnosis; EPA-compliant technicians must locate leaks, address them, and conduct refrigerant recovery before recharging the system to manufacturer specifications.
Duct defects produce similar symptoms. If treated air exits through disconnected joints, damaged runs, or unsealed plenums, rooms obtain less airflow even when the blower operates normally. You may also have pressure variations that pull hot attic air into return ducts. A technician should examine static pressure, seal leaks, confirm insulation, and execute duct balancing so each register supplies the designed air movement and temperature.
How Experts Pinpoint HVAC Malfunctions in Alvin
The assessment initiates with AC metrics and documented operation: an Alvin specialist will check thermostat settings, check the air filter, and document inlet-outlet temperature differential, static pressure, voltage, amperage, and refrigerant levels before making diagnoses.
From that step, you'll see professionals match those data against OEM specifications and local building codes. They deploy evaluation tools to check capacitors, contactors, relays, blower efficiency, condensate safety sensors, and compressor winding integrity. They also examine system background, including earlier repairs, ongoing fault trends, and maintenance intervals, because data often identify underlying problems. If airflow is insufficient, they'll isolate impediments in ducts, coils, registers, or the blower unit. If electrical measurements deviate, they'll track loose connections, inconsistency, or circuit board defects. This methodical method ensures you get accurate diagnoses, standards-compliant service, and repairs that correct root problems.
Should You Restore or Replace Your AC?
When you're deciding whether to repair or replace your AC, the proper answer is based on assessed condition, repair cost, performance loss, and residual service life—not guesswork.
Before deciding, you should examine compressor integrity, refrigerant circuit leakage, blower function, coil condition, and control-board reliability.
Repair usually makes sense if your system cools within manufacturer specifications and the failure is contained.
If testing indicates repeated component degradation, dropping energy efficiency, R-22 dependence, or structural corrosion, replacement is usually the appropriate option.
You should also compare SEER performance against present standards, confirm duct compatibility, and examine warranty transferability if the property changes hands.
A certified load calculation and static-pressure test will reveal whether your existing equipment is correctly sized.
That data permits you to reach a justified decision based on performance, risk, and sustained reliability.
What Does Air Conditioning Repair Cost in Alvin?
The cost of AC repair in Alvin differs significantly, but you can estimate more accurately by considering the defective component, diagnosis report, refrigerant type, labor duration, and compliance-related fixes. A capacitor or contactor replacement usually costs less than a motor assembly, electronic board, or evaporator coil replacement. When your system requires discontinued refrigerant, material fees escalate fast.
You should also factor in leak testing, electrical diagnostics, air flow measurement, and thermostat calibration, since validated diagnostics affect total labor time. During high summer demand, seasonal pricing can increase rates, and emergency fees apply if you schedule after-hours or weekend service. Your invoice will grow if the technician must address unsafe wiring, drainage issues, or clearance violations to satisfy code requirements. Ask for an breakdown estimate so you can evaluate parts, labor, and code-related work accurately.
